Abstract

The disclosure provides a data processing method and device, electronic equipment and a computer readable medium, and relates to the technical field of computers. The method comprises the following steps: determining a display area corresponding to target content in a current display page; determining a data display area corresponding to at least one piece of data in a current display page; and if the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content are detected to have an overlapping area, adjusting the display parameters of the current display page to enable the target content to be displayed on the current display page. The method and the device avoid the target content in the current display page from being blocked by data.

Background
At present, a plurality of data for the content are often displayed simultaneously when the content such as a video, a picture or a moving picture is displayed, and due to the excessive amount of the data, a display area corresponding to the data may block a display area corresponding to important content in the content, so that the data blocks the important content, and the display of the important content is affected.

In order to solve the problem that the display of important content in a display page may be blocked when the number of the existing barrage is too large, so that the display of the important content is affected, the present disclosure provides a data processing method, which may be executed by a terminal device, where the terminal device may be a mobile terminal or a desktop terminal, and the method may include:
s101, determining a display area corresponding to target content in a current display page;
the terminal device may directly determine a display area corresponding to the target content in the current display page, or after determining the target content in the content displayed on the current display page, the terminal device may determine the display area corresponding to the target content in the current display page. The terminal device selects the display area through the mask tool box, the display area is the mask area, and therefore the target content corresponding to the display area can form a page independent of the current display page, and the terminal device can directly operate the page corresponding to the target content.
In this embodiment, the current presentation page may be understood as a presentation page presented on the display screen of the terminal at the current time. The display page may display at least one of a video, a text, a picture, and a moving picture, and the current display page may be a video display page (at this time, the current display page is specifically a display page of a certain video frame image in a video), may also be a picture display page, and may also be a moving picture display page. Meanwhile, when the current display page displays a video or a picture or an animation, the text corresponding to the video or the picture or the animation can be displayed.
In some application scenarios, the page layout of the currently presented page may have a preset layout. In the application scenes, the display area of the target content in the current display page can be determined according to the preset formats.
S102, determining a data display area corresponding to at least one piece of data in the current display page;
the terminal equipment determines at least one piece of data which is displayed synchronously with the target content in the current display page, and determines a data display area corresponding to each piece of data in all or part of data.
In this embodiment, the data may be displayed in a sliding manner on the display page (including the current display page), and may disappear after sliding the display page from one position of the display page to another position of the display page, for example, disappear after sliding from the right of the display page to the left of the display page. In which case the data presentation area of the data is time-varying. However, it can be understood that the data display area corresponding to the data on the display page at the current time is unique. The data display mode can also be fixed in a specific data display area of the display page for display. For example, the data may disappear from the specific data presentation area after the preset presentation duration is reached, in which case the data corresponds to a unique specific data presentation area.
In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the data displayed on the current display page may be the bullet screen content displayed on the current display page, and the data display area corresponding to the data may be a bullet screen display area. It is understood that the data is the bullet screen content only as one possible example, and the data may be a picture, a video, a dynamic image, etc. overlapping with the target content in addition to the bullet screen content.
In this embodiment, taking data in the bullet screen content as an example, the bullet screen content may be bullet screen content acquired based on online comment of a user when the terminal device displays a video or a picture or a motion picture, or bullet screen content generated by a user commenting in advance before the terminal device displays the video or the picture or the motion picture, and the terminal device may acquire the bullet screen content generated by commenting in advance from a database.
Step S103, if the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content are detected to have an overlapping area, adjusting the display parameters of the current display page to enable the target content to be displayed on the current display page.
In this embodiment, the overlapping area between the bullet screen display area of the data and the display area of the target content may be a partial overlap or a complete overlap between the bullet screen display area of the data and the display area of the target content.
In this embodiment, the display parameter of the current display page refers to a parameter for controlling a content display mode in the current display page, and the adjusting the display parameter of the current display page includes: the display parameters of the target content displayed on the current display page are adjusted and/or the display parameters of the data (which may be bullet screen content) displayed on the current display page are adjusted, so that the target content can be displayed on the current display page, and the target content displayed on the current display page means that the target content is visible (or perceptible) to the user, so that the data with the overlapping area can be completely shielded by the target content, or the data with the overlapping area can not be completely shielded by the target content, but even if the display area of the data overlaps with the display area of the target content, the effect of the target content visible to the user cannot be influenced.
When there is overlap area in the bullet screen show area of bullet screen content and the show area of target content, can cause the sheltering from of bullet screen content to target content, this disclosed terminal equipment can adjust the display parameter of this bullet screen content and/or the display parameter of target content automatically, can reach the effect of hiding this bullet screen content, hide this bullet screen content can be to make bullet screen content hide completely, bullet screen content is completely invisible promptly, also can be to make the visibility of bullet screen content reduce, but not completely invisible, as long as do not influence the target content can to the visible effect of user. Therefore, even if the bullet screen display area of the bullet screen content and the display area of the target content have the overlapping area, the bullet screen content can be prevented from being shielded when the target content is displayed, and the target content can be displayed completely and clearly.
In this embodiment, a display area corresponding to target content in a current display page is determined, and a data display area corresponding to at least one piece of data in the current display page is determined, and if it is detected that an overlapping area exists between the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content, a display parameter of the current display page can be adjusted, so that the target content is displayed on the current display page, thereby avoiding the shielding of the data on the important content in the current display page, not affecting the display of the important content, optimizing the display effect of the target content in the current display page, and improving the user experience.
Specifically, in this embodiment, the following possible implementation manners are possible to adjust the display parameters of the bullet screen content and/or the display parameters of the target content:
(1) one possible way is: the opacity through adjusting bullet screen content is so that target content does not sheltered from by bullet screen content when showing, and the opacity is lower, and is more invisible to the user, and the hidden effect is better, specific:
optionally, the display parameter of the current display page includes opacity when data is displayed;
in step S103, if it is detected that there is an overlapping area between the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content, adjusting the display parameter of the current display page may include:
and if the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content are detected to have an overlapping area, reducing the opacity when the data with the overlapping area is displayed so that the opacity when the data with the overlapping area is displayed is not higher than the preset opacity.
In this embodiment, if it is detected that there is an overlapping area between the bullet screen display area of any one of the bullet screen contents and the display area of the target content, the opacity of the bullet screen contents may be reduced, so that the opacity of the reduced bullet screen contents is not higher than the preset opacity, where the preset opacity is a preset opacity, and the preset opacity may be set as required, for example, when the opacity is 100%, the bullet screen contents are completely visible, when the opacity is 0, the bullet screen contents are completely invisible, and the preset opacity may be set as 0, which means that the opacity of the bullet screen contents may be reduced to 0, in this case, the bullet screen contents are completely hidden, or the preset opacity may be set to be small enough but not required to be 0, and only after the opacity of the bullet screen contents is reduced to not higher than the preset opacity, the target content is not shielded, in this case, the bullet-screen content may not be completely hidden but may not occlude the target content.
Fig. 2(a) is a schematic view of a scenario of the data processing method of the present disclosure, and referring to fig. 2(a), a possible application scenario of the present embodiment is as follows:
the present show page show has personage and literal information (literal information is the literal element in the embodiment behind), the present show page includes barrage 1 to barrage 4, terminal equipment confirms the display area of portrait and literal information, and behind the barrage display area of barrage 1 to barrage 4, confirm that barrage 1 has sheltered from the portrait, barrage 4 has sheltered from literal information, then terminal equipment can reduce the opacity of barrage 1 and barrage 4 automatically, the display effect of final present show page is shown as figure 2(a), portrait and literal information can not shelter from by the barrage during the display.
Optionally, the method further includes:
and if it is detected that the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content do not have an overlapping area, and the opacity when the data without the overlapping area is displayed is not higher than the preset opacity, increasing the opacity when the data without the overlapping area is displayed.
The opacity of bullet screen content is adjustable, and there is not the overlap portion in the bullet screen display area that arbitrary bullet screen content corresponds and the display area of target content, but the opacity of bullet screen content is not higher than above-mentioned preset opacity, then can increase the opacity of bullet screen content to normally show bullet screen content, make bullet screen content visible to the user, except the display area that target content corresponds in the present show page like this, bullet screen content all can normally show in other regions.
For example, the bullet screen content may be displayed in a sliding manner on a display page, when the bullet screen content slides to overlap with the display area of the target content, the opacity of the bullet screen content is reduced (at this time, the current display page in step S101 is the display page when the bullet screen content slides to overlap with the display area of the target content), and when the bullet screen content slides to be not overlapped with the display area of the target content, the opacity of the bullet screen content may be increased again because the opacity of the bullet screen content is not higher than the preset opacity (at this time, the current display page in step S101 is the display page when the bullet screen content slides to be not overlapped with the display area of the target content).
Fig. 2(b) is a schematic view of another scenario of the data processing method of the present disclosure, after the opacity of bullet screen 1 and bullet screen 4 is reduced in fig. 2(a), because the bullet screen is displayed in a sliding way, when the bullet screen 1 slides to be not coincident with the head portrait of a person and the bullet screen 4 also slides to be not coincident with the character information, the opacity of the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 is still the opacity of the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 with the reduced opacity in fig. 2(a), the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 are hidden in the current display page, invisible to the user, or bullet screen 1 and bullet screen 4 are not completely hidden but do not occlude the target content, the terminal device may automatically adjust (also based on user operation) the opacity of the bullet screen 1 and bullet screen 4 to redisplay the bullet screen 1 and bullet screen 4 so that the bullet screen 1 and bullet screen 4 are visible to the user.
In this embodiment, can be through the hiding or the show of regulation control bullet screen content based on opacity, avoided the sheltering from of bullet screen content to target content, can guarantee the normal show of bullet screen content in other regions except that target content place area again, simultaneously, terminal equipment can be to the regulation quick response of opacity, terminal equipment processing flow is shorter, and data processing is fast, and user operation is also fairly simple, has promoted user experience.
(2) Another possible way is: the bullet screen content can block the target content because the page level of the bullet screen content is higher than that of the target content (the page level of the target content is the page level of the currently displayed page), and the target content is not blocked by the bullet screen content when being displayed by adjusting the page level of the bullet screen content and/or the page level of the target content, specifically:
optionally, the current display page is an image display page, and the display parameters of the current display page include a page level corresponding to the data and/or a page level corresponding to the target content;
in step S103, if it is detected that there is an overlapping area between the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content, adjusting the display parameter of the current display page may include:
if the data display area of the data and the display area of the target content are detected to have the overlapping area, adjusting the page level corresponding to the target content and/or the page level corresponding to the data having the overlapping area, so that the adjusted page level corresponding to the data having the overlapping area is lower than the page level corresponding to the target content.
In this embodiment, first, it should be noted that a page level of a certain page refers to a level corresponding to the page when the page is displayed on the terminal device, generally, if display areas of two pages are overlapped, a page of a higher level may completely block a page of a lower level, for example, if a page of an a page is overlapped with a display area of a page of a B page, and a page level of the a page is higher than a page level of the page of the B page, the page of the a page may completely block the display of the page of the B page, the page of the a page is visible to a user, and the page of the B page is not completely visible to the user.
In this embodiment, there are multiple possible implementation manners for adjusting the page level corresponding to the target content and/or the page level corresponding to the data having the overlapping area, and the following four possible implementation manners are described in detail below:
1. one way to implement the method is to, when it is detected that there is an overlapping area between the bullet screen display area of any bullet screen content and the display area of the target content, keep the page level corresponding to the target content unchanged, and adjust the page level corresponding to the bullet screen content, so that the adjusted page level corresponding to the bullet screen content is lower than the page level corresponding to the target content, thereby completely hiding the bullet screen content and avoiding the blocking of the bullet screen content on the target content.
Fig. 3(a) is another scene schematic diagram of the data processing method of the present disclosure, and similarly, the bullet screen 1 blocks the portrait, and the bullet screen 4 blocks the text information, then the terminal device reduces the page level of the bullet screen 1 to be lower than the page level of the portrait, and reduces the page level of the bullet screen 4 to be lower than the page level of the text information, both the page level of the portrait and the page level of the text information are the page levels of the currently displayed page, and finally, the display effect of the currently displayed page is as shown in fig. 3(a), and neither the portrait nor the text information is blocked by the bullet screen when displayed.
2. Another way to implement the method is that when an overlapping area between a bullet screen display area of any bullet screen content and a display area of a target content is detected, a page level corresponding to the bullet screen content can be kept unchanged, the page level corresponding to the target content is adjusted, the page level of the target content can be adjusted to be higher than that of the bullet screen content, and the page level of the target content can also be directly adjusted to be the highest page level, so that the bullet screen content is completely hidden, and the target content is prevented from being blocked by the bullet screen content.
Fig. 3(b) is another scene schematic diagram of the data processing method of the present disclosure, and similarly, the bullet screen 1 blocks the portrait, and the bullet screen 4 blocks the text information, as described above, the display area corresponding to the target content can be framed by the masking tool, so that the masking area corresponding to the target content is an individual operable page, that is, the portrait and the text information respectively correspond to an individual page, the terminal device can raise the page level of the portrait and the page level of the text information to be higher than the page level of the bullet screen, and finally, the display effect of the currently displayed page is as shown in fig. 3(b), and neither the portrait nor the text information is blocked by the bullet screen when displayed.
3. Another way to implement the method is that, after a display area corresponding to target content in a current display page is selected by a mask tool box, whether an overlapping area exists between a bullet screen display area of any bullet screen content and the display area of the target content is detected, a page level of a page corresponding to the display area (namely, a page level corresponding to the target content) can be set as a highest page level, so that when the display area of any bullet screen content overlaps with the display area of the target content, the target content cannot be shielded, and the bullet screen content can be completely hidden.
4. In another implementation manner, the page level corresponding to the barrage content and the page level corresponding to the target content may be adjusted at the same time, so that the page level corresponding to the barrage content is lower than the page level corresponding to the target content.
Optionally, the method further includes:
if it is detected that there is no overlapping area between the data display area corresponding to the data and the display area of the target content, and the page level corresponding to the data without the overlapping area is lower than the page level corresponding to the current display page, adjusting the page level corresponding to the data without the overlapping area, so that the adjusted page level corresponding to the data without the overlapping area is higher than the page level of the current display page.
In order to ensure that the bullet screen content is normally displayed on the current display page, when it is detected that the bullet screen content slides to the bullet screen display area of the bullet screen content and the display area of the target content without an overlapping area and the page level of the bullet screen content is lower than that of the current display page, the page level of the bullet screen content is increased, so that the page level of the bullet screen content after being increased is higher than that of the current display page, and the bullet screen content can be normally displayed in other areas except for the display area corresponding to the target content in the current display page.
As described above, the bullet screen content may be displayed in a sliding manner on the display page, when the bullet screen content slides to overlap with the display area of the target content, the page level of the bullet screen content is reduced (at this time, the current display page in step S101 is the display page when the bullet screen content slides to overlap with the display area of the target content), and when the bullet screen content slides to not overlap with the display area of the target content, the page level of the bullet screen content may be increased again because the page level of the bullet screen content is lower than the page level of the current display page (at this time, the current display page in step S101 is the display page when the bullet screen content slides to not overlap with the display area of the target content).
Referring to fig. 3(c), as another scene schematic diagram of the data processing method of the present disclosure, after the page levels of the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 are reduced in fig. 3(a), because the bullet screen is displayed in a sliding manner, when the bullet screen 1 slides to be not overlapped with the portrait and the bullet screen 4 also slides to be not overlapped with the text information, the page levels of the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 are still the page levels of the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 after the page level is reduced in fig. 3(a), and the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 are invisible to the user, the terminal device may automatically enhance (or may be based on a user operation) the page levels of the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 to redisplay the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4, so that the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4 are visible to the user.
In this embodiment, can adjust through the page level to the page information of bullet screen content or target content to do not sheltered from by bullet screen content when guaranteeing target content display, can guarantee again that bullet screen content corresponds the regional normal show outside the show area at target content, terminal equipment can respond fast to the regulation of page level, and terminal equipment handles the flow shorter, and data processing is fast, and user operation is also fairly simple, has promoted user experience.
(3) Yet another possibility is: the display parameter of the bullet screen content can be the display position of the bullet screen content on the current display page.
Terminal equipment detects that there is the overlap region in the bullet screen display region of arbitrary bullet screen content and the display region of target content, can change the position of the bullet screen display region that bullet screen content corresponds, thereby the change is the display position of bullet screen content at present show page, make the bullet screen display region after the position change avoid the display region that target content corresponds, also can avoid the sheltering from of bullet screen content to target content like this, for example, when bullet screen content slides to overlap with the text message in present show page, can adjust bullet screen content to the regional show outside this text message place region in present show page.
Referring to fig. 4, which is another scene schematic diagram of the data processing method disclosed in the present disclosure, a bullet screen 1 blocks a portrait, a bullet screen 4 blocks character information, then a terminal device changes bullet screen display areas of the bullet screen 1 and the bullet screen 4, the bullet screen 1 can be adjusted to the top of the portrait, the bullet screen 4 is adjusted to the bottom of the character information, finally, a display effect of a current display page is as shown in fig. 4, and the portrait and the character information are not blocked by the bullet screen when displayed.
Optionally, determining a display area corresponding to the target content in the current display page includes:
identifying position information of content elements in a current display page;
determining a display area corresponding to the target content based on the position information of the content element;
wherein the target content comprises at least one content element.
In this embodiment, the terminal device may identify position information of all or part of content elements in the current presentation page, and for one content element, specifically: after the terminal equipment can identify the content element in the current display page, the position information corresponding to the content element is determined; the terminal equipment can also directly obtain the position information of the content element in the current display page based on the neural network identification.
The terminal device may determine a presentation area corresponding to the target content based on the position information of the content element included in the target content in the position information of all or part of the content elements, where the target content may include at least one content element.
Further, identifying location information of the content element in the current presentation page includes at least one of:
if the content elements comprise character elements, performing optical character recognition on the content elements in the current display page, determining the character elements in the content elements, and determining position information of the character elements;
and if the content elements comprise face elements, carrying out face recognition on the content elements in the current display page, determining the face elements in the content elements, and determining the position information of the face elements.
In the embodiment of the disclosure, before the terminal device determines the display area corresponding to the target content in the current display page, the terminal device may obtain the displayed content of the current display page, and after the terminal device may obtain the video, extract at least one video frame image in the video, and use the video frame image as the content displayed by the current display page.
In this embodiment, the terminal device may perform Optical Character Recognition (OCR) on all or a part of content elements displayed on the current display page to determine text elements in the current display page, the terminal device may also perform face Recognition on all or a part of content elements displayed on the current display page to determine face elements in the current display page, the target content may include at least one of the text elements and the face elements, and the target content may be other content elements besides the face elements and/or the text elements, such as product image elements.
